During their panel at Anime Expo, Crunchyroll confirmed the rumors that Black Clover will be officially returning for an all-new season only on Crunchyroll. Studio Pierrot (Naruto; Bleach; Tokyo Ghoul) will be back to produce the series.
Along with this exciting news, where fans in the panel were the first in the world to learn, a message from the original creator, Yuki Tabata, was also delivered in celebration of the 10th anniversary of the manga that the anime is adapted from:
“The production of the long-awaited new anime season of Black Clover has been confirmed! I’m beyond ecstatic going into the new anime season after the super-passionate movie that came out! Thanks to all of you, Black Clover is celebrating its 10th anniversary this year! I definitely plan to keep this hype going! I want fans from Japan and all around the world to enjoy the powered-up anime that’s going to be brought to you by the most awesome anime production staff! Thank you so much for supporting Black Clover!”
